Ready for the cutest, fastest, and furriest card game you'll find? In Crazy Corgi, the mission is simple and adorable: find a cozy home for your fluffy corgi puppies. But be careful not to get too greedy, or these mischievous pups will dash to another player's kennels! This is a vibrant game for 2 to 4 players, recommended for ages 6 and up, with matches flying by in just 15 to 20 minutes. The main goal is to accumulate points by forming sets of five cards in your three kennels. Scoring varies according to the combinations you manage to assemble, so keep an eye out for the best plays. At the beginning of each round, you draw 2 to 4 cards from the deck, hoping that none of them have the same number. If luck is on your side and the cards are all different, you add them to your kennels, expanding your collections. But if luck turns and you draw two cards with the same number, they'll end up in another player's hands, who will add them to their own kennels. Oh, and there's one more crucial detail: if you can't fit a card into a kennel without creating an invalid combination, you'll have to discard one of your kennels to start a new one. The race to victory is fierce: the first player to reach 5 points is the grand winner and the corgi master!

What is the minimum age recommended for Crazy Corgi?
From 6 years old, kids can have a lot of fun with the corgis!
How many players can participate in a game?
Crazy Corgi is ideal for 2 to 4 players, perfect for a family afternoon or with friends.
What is the average duration of a game?
Games are super fast, taking 15 to 20 minutes. You can play several rounds!
Is the game very complex?
Not at all! It has a very light complexity (BGG weight of 1.17), easy to pick up the rules and start playing.
What is the main objective of the game?
The goal is to be the first to score 5 points by forming sets of 5 cards in your kennels. But be careful not to push your luck too much!
Does Crazy Corgi have language-dependent components?
No, the game is completely language-independent, so anyone can play without problems!
Is it a good game for those who like 'push your luck' mechanics?
Absolutely! The 'Push Your Luck' mechanic is the heart of the game, making you decide at every moment if it's worth risking one more card.
